West Lothian Council cuts soar to £60 million

PLANNED budget cuts of £45m across West Lothian Council over the next few years will rise to a staggering £60 million.

A fresh look at figures found the new cuts total stands at around 58.5m over the next four years, with an 'unprecedented' 20m to be found for 2011/12.

Council chiefs are calling the situation ''very challenging''.

The council's financial position was re-calculated following an assessment of the UK Emergency Budget and a summary of the Scottish Government's Independent Budget Review – but the figure is still a guesstimate until full information in available in November.
